-bash:/Library/Frameworks/Python.framework/Versions/3.6/bin/pip:没有这样的文件或目录
我在python方面有很多问题,我想我把事情搞砸了。当我输入到终端时-bash:/Library/Frameworks/Python.framework/Versions/3.6/bin/pip:没有这样的文件或目录,python,python-3.x,pip,Python,Python 3.x,Pip,我在python方面有很多问题,我想我把事情搞砸了。当我输入到终端时 $which python 它回来了 /usr/bin/python 然后当我打字的时候 $pip install google 上面说 -bash: /Library/Frameworks/Python.framework/Versions/3.6/bin/pip: No such file or directory 我如何解决这个问题?我真的很感谢你的帮助 如果您使用Python3安装了pip,您可能需要运行pip
$which python
它回来了
/usr/bin/python
然后当我打字的时候
$pip install google
上面说
-bash: /Library/Frameworks/Python.framework/Versions/3.6/bin/pip: No such file or directory
我如何解决这个问题?我真的很感谢你的帮助 如果您使用Python3安装了pip,您可能需要运行
pip3
,而不是pip
。此外,您可能应该使用类似于virtualenv
的工具来管理不同的环境和包
您还可以尝试使用从中获取pip.py脚本重新安装pip
安装pip
要安装pip,请安全下载
然后运行以下操作(可能需要管理员访问):
如果尚未安装setuptools
,get pip.py
将为您安装setuptools
如果仍然存在问题,请尝试从头开始安装virtualenv和软件包,看看它是否有效:
$ virtualenv venv
$ source venv/bin/activate
(venv) $ venv/bin/pip install google-cloud-storage
(venv) $ venv/bin/python -c 'import google.cloud.storage'
在
/Library/Frameworks/Python.framework/Versions/3.6/bin/
中执行ln-s/usr/bin/pip
和ln-s/usr/bin/pip3
那帮我修好了。在那之后,我不得不强迫pip再次升级自己。我太爱你了!你是有史以来最伟大的人!但我仍然得到了错误回溯(最近一次调用是最后一次):文件“”,第1行,在ImportError中:没有名为google的模块,即使在中“成功安装了beautifulsoup4-4.6.0 google-2.0.1”terminal@GoopieGoogpie我建议您尝试安装virtualenv或Anaconda,并尝试从头开始重新创建您的环境。这种方法很可能会让你运气更好。我相应地更新了答案。一旦我创建了虚拟环境,我如何让我的文件使用它?(我使用ATOM运行带有脚本插件的python文件)
$ virtualenv venv
$ source venv/bin/activate
(venv) $ venv/bin/pip install google-cloud-storage
(venv) $ venv/bin/python -c 'import google.cloud.storage'